Life insurance
|
Life insurance is one of the most common types of insurance and offers cover to your family if the policyholder were to die. Typically, this will involve the payment of a regular income or to pay off a family's mortgage debt or a combination of the two.
There are many other similar types of insurance such as best term life insurance, life and critical illness insurance and whole life insurance. There are different types of life insurance products available which include level and decreasing term cover.
